Product Description
- SPSS (Statistical Package for the Social Sciences) is a data management and analysis software that allows users to generate solid, decision-making results by performing statistical analysis
- This book provides just the information needed: installing the software, entering data, setting up calculations, and analyzing data
- Covers computing cross tabulation, frequencies, descriptive ratios, means, bivariate and partial correlations, linear regression, and much more
- Explains how to output information into striking charts and graphs
- For ambitious users, also covers how to program SPSS to take their statistical analysis to the next level

SPSS for Dummies October 20, 2009 med student I bought this book because I needed to use SPSS and had no experience with the program. I read Chapter 1 and Chapter 4 to start and this gave me a good basis. Then I read other chapters as questions came up. If you are used to using computers and learning how to do new things on the computer, then this book is perfect for you. Do not get this book if you are looking for a book to tell you when to run which statistics. This book tells you HOW, not WHEN or WHY. I supplemented the book with SPSS Help menu and internet sights for more complex actions like regression. Overall, I would recommend this book!
Getting started isn't enough, esp. for dummies October 18, 2009 Ashish Kumar (Singapore) I brought this book with the hope that - together with another marketing research theory book - it would help me through my thesis fieldwork.
As it happens, it won't and I'm scouting for my next SPSS book a few weeks after buying this one.
It's well written, and it bridges the gap between the SPSS help and the statistics books. What it doesn't do is explain a bit of stats for dummies, which I think I was reasonable to expect. I can run the software and do a few things with this book. I can't get answers to questions like "if I have to test --- hypotheses, which is the test and what options do I use".
The book would become really useful if this content was added on.
